    Motorola Unveils Unified AI Platform and AI Pin-Styled Wearable Device Prototype at CES 2026

    4 days ago

    Motorola’s showcase at the Consumer Electronics Show (CES) 2026 included two major AI announcements. First is Qira, the Lenovo-owned company’s unified AI platform that preserves context and memory when the user moves from one device to another. The second is Project Maxwell, a wearable companion device built on the Qira platform. It is currently a proof of concept with no launch date in sight.
